BdAPIs vs IPWhois: common questions
Which is more reliable, BdAPIs or IPWhois?
Both are neck-and-neck — BdAPIs and IPWhois each measure 100% uptime over 90 days on our probe schedule. Reliability here is verified from our own scheduled checks; use the 30-day bars above to see which has been steadier lately.
Which is faster, BdAPIs or IPWhois?
IPWhois has the lower median latency in our checks — BdAPIs responds in 817 ms versus IPWhois at 23 ms (P50). Tail latency (P95) is in the table above; for most workloads the median is the number that shapes how the API feels.
Do BdAPIs and IPWhois need an API key?
BdAPIs needs no key, while IPWhois requires a free API key. If you want to start calling without signup, reach for BdAPIs first.
Can I call BdAPIs and IPWhois from the browser?
Only BdAPIs is browser-friendly — it returns CORS headers over HTTPS. IPWhois needs a server-side call or proxy, so factor that into which one fits a front-end project.
Are BdAPIs and IPWhois free for commercial use?
BdAPIs has unclear commercial terms, and IPWhois has unclear commercial terms. We track service terms and the data license as separate fields — see the Commercial use and Data license rows above, and confirm both before shipping either in a paid product.
